Interior Painting Question..

I was thinking of doing a white/red colour scheme inside of my car, and I was wondering if anyone has done their interior white before? In my last car, I did it white and blue, and the white part got dirty so easily, and when I went to clean it, it just made it worse. Does anyone have custom white interior that actually looks decent, and isn't so hard to maintain?
If so any tips on painting would be appreciated, thanks in advance

hey scarlumthug,

that interior, did u have to take the entire dash board out to paint it? or was it painted without taking it out?

Thats one my buddies rides, he has a complete redone interior now. I will post pics up if you want.

He didnt take out the dash but just taped EVERYTHING off and then sprayed the dye on it. If you can take the dash out it would be easier though.
